Stephen Williams is an accomplished television director and producer, renowned for his work on a wide range of critically acclaimed and popular projects.
One of his most notable credits is the 2019 series "Watchmen", a groundbreaking and highly acclaimed adaptation of the iconic graphic novel of the same name.
Prior to this, Williams made a significant impact in the television industry with his work on the popular and long-running series "Lost", which premiered in 2004 and ran for six seasons.
In addition to his work on "Watchmen" and "Lost", Williams has also directed and produced several other notable projects, including the 2010 series "Undercovers".
